Butane, 1-chloro-
- Formula: C4H9Cl
- Molecular weight: 92.567
- IUPAC Standard InChIKey: VFWCMGCRMGJXDK-UHFFFAOYSA-N
- CAS Registry Number: 109-69-3

View 3d structure (requires JavaScript / HTML 5) - Other names: n-Butyl chloride; n-Propylcarbinyl chloride; Butyl chloride; 1-Chlorobutane; n-C4H9Cl; Chlorure de butyle; NBC wormer; NCI-C06155; Sure Shot; NSC 8419

Normal boiling point

Data compiled as indicated in comments:
BS - Robert L. Brown and Stephen E. Stein
TRC - Thermodynamics Research Center, NIST Boulder Laboratories, Chris Muzny director
Tboil (K) | Reference | Comment |
---|---|---|
351.6 | Weast and Grasselli, 1989 | BS |
381.4 | Mouli, Naidu, et al., 1986 | Uncertainty assigned by TRC = 0.2 K; TRC |
351.7 | Majer and Svoboda, 1985 | |
351.65 | Skinner, Cussler, et al., 1968 | Uncertainty assigned by TRC = 0.5 K; TRC |
351.35 | Amaya, 1961 | Uncertainty assigned by TRC = 0.5 K; TRC |
350.65 | Ford, Hanford, et al., 1952 | Uncertainty assigned by TRC = 1.5 K; TRC |
351.55 | Mumford and Phillips, 1950 | Uncertainty assigned by TRC = 0.3 K; TRC |
351.59 | Dreisbach and Martin, 1949 | Uncertainty assigned by TRC = 0.07 K; TRC |
323.95 | Lecat, 1947 | Uncertainty assigned by TRC = 0.6 K; TRC |
350.85 | Mathews and Fehlandt, 1931 | Uncertainty assigned by TRC = 0.4 K; TRC |
351.65 | Timmermans and Hennaut-Roland, 1930 | Uncertainty assigned by TRC = 0.2 K; TRC |
350.6 | Smyth and Engel, 1929 | Uncertainty assigned by TRC = 0.3 K; TRC |
351.20 | Lecat, 1927 | Uncertainty assigned by TRC = 0.5 K; TRC |
351.75 | Timmermans, 1921 | Uncertainty assigned by TRC = 0.3 K; TRC |
